1 – Introduction 

    Le langage javascript est un langage orienté objet, en plus il est doté de l'avantage de manipulation d'objets sans instanciation, et par suite vous pouvez manipuler tous ce qui apparaissent dans votre browser : fenêtres corps du document, boutons, zones de texte... comme etant des objets javascript. Nous n'allons pas ici traiter le coté POO du javascript proprement dit mais quelque exemple d'objets fondamentaux. Pour accéder aux propriétés d'un objet on utilise la syntaxe:
objet.propriété

2 - L'objet window

    Tous les composants d'une page web sont des objets y compris l'objet windows qui est leur parent, l'objet window est parfois appelé l'objet par excellence. Exemple pour écrire un texte on utilise la syntaxe :
   
window.document.write('bonjour');

2.1 - Les propriétés et méthodes de l'objet window

Propriété ou méthode
Description
document
permet d'accéder à tous les objets
status
affiche un message dans la barre d'état
name
le nom de la fenêtre actuelle
window
fenêtre actuelle
Home()
permet d'atteindre la page d'accueil
Alert()
affiche un message sur une boite
Prompt()
affichage d'une boite qui contrôle la saisi clavier
Close()
ferme la fenêtre
Open()
ouvre une fenêtre pop-up
Blur()
cache la fenêtre
resizeBy()
permet de modifier les dimensions de la fenêtre

Exemple : affichage dans la barre d'état le texte "Vous êtes sur le site du CRMEF OUJDA"

Exemple : Voici un exemple de code Javascript affichant deux boutons, un pour cacher la fenêtre, l'autre pour fermer la fenêtre


<INPUT type="button" value="cachez la fenêtre" onClick="window.blur();">

<INPUT type="button" value="fermer la fenêtre" onClick="window.close();">

En visualisant le code ci-dessus sur le navigateur on obtient  :

Exemple : Ouverture d'une fenêtre pop_up

Leave a Reply